The Distributed Acoustic Sensing Market is on the brink of significant expansion, projected to reach a market size of $1,196.95 million by 2035, reflecting a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 8.9%. This sharp rise is fueled by technological advancements and an increasing demand for real-time monitoring solutions across various industries. The implications of this growth are profound, not only for existing players but also for potential entrants looking to capitalize on emerging opportunities. As infrastructure develops and industries seek innovative solutions, the market dynamics are shifting dramatically, unlocking investment opportunities that could reshape the landscape of acoustic sensing technologies. Additionally, a robust market analysis reveals that North America remains the largest market segment, while the Asia-Pacific region is emerging as the fastest-growing area, highlighting a shift in demand and innovation efforts globally.

Several companies are at the forefront of this transformation. The competitive landscape features companies like OptaSense (GB), Silixa (GB), and Fotech Solutions (GB), which are driving innovation in sensing technologies. These firms are not only enhancing their technological capabilities but also expanding their geographical reach to meet the growing demand. Baker Hughes (US), Schlumberger (US), and Halliburton (US) are also instrumental in shaping industry trends, bringing their extensive experience and resources to the acoustic sensing market. Furthermore, firms like Aker Solutions (NO) and Sercel (FR) are contributing to advancements in data collection and analysis, ensuring that real-time monitoring becomes more sophisticated and effective. Geographically, North America continues to lead the market, with significant investments in technology and infrastructure. This region's established player base and increasing adoption of real-time monitoring solutions position it as a critical player in the distributed acoustic sensing landscape. In contrast, the Asia-Pacific region is rapidly gaining momentum, driven by rapid industrialization and urbanization. As countries in this region invest heavily in infrastructure projects, the demand for distributed acoustic sensing technologies is projected to rise sharply. According to recent data, the Asia-Pacific market is expected to grow at a CAGR of over 10% by 2030, outpacing North American growth. The differences in market dynamics across these regions underline the necessity for tailored strategies that consider local conditions and regulatory environments, providing insights into potential investment opportunities.

Investment opportunities abound as the market continues to evolve. The increasing need for surveillance and monitoring in sectors such as oil and gas, transportation, and infrastructure creates a fertile ground for innovation. A report by MarketsandMarkets indicates that the oil and gas sector accounts for approximately 45% of the overall demand for distributed acoustic sensing systems, driven by the need for pipeline monitoring and leak detection solutions. AI Impact Analysis

The influence of artificial intelligence and machine learning on the Distributed Acoustic Sensing Market cannot be overstated. These technologies are transforming how data is analyzed and interpreted, enabling real-time processing and insightful analytics that were previously unattainable. For instance, AI-driven algorithms can enhance signal detection, reducing noise and improving the accuracy of the data collected.
